From Damascus, which he loved with all its details, the body of the great film director Abdel Latif Abdel Hamid set off to his city of Latakia, with the presence of a large number of artists. The funeral procession for the body of the late Syrian director Abdel Hamid, which began this morning in front of Ibn al-Nafis Hospital in Damascus and arrived at noon in Lattakia, was attended popularly and officially to bid farewell to a great director who was able to convey the image of the Syrian countryside with its beauty, purity and simplicity. The body was buried in his village of Bahluliya in the countryside of Latakia. The great director Abdel Hamid, passed away at the age of 70, leaving behind a rich cinematic legacy and a career filled with about 20 works. Source: Syrian Arab News Agency
